What to Eat
Kaysersberg-Vignoble is known for its Alsatian cuisine. Some of the most popular dishes include:
- Baeckeoffe
- Choucroute
- Tarte flambée
- Kougelhopf
Where to Go
There are many things to see and do in Kaysersberg-Vignoble. Some of the most popular attractions include:
- The Château de Kaysersberg
- The Musée Albert Schweitzer
- The Église Saint-Michel
- The Rue des Juifs
